EVO magazine (October 2001 - no.36) rated the 1973 911 2.7 RS the greatest Porsche 911 of all.
The '73 2.7 RS was up against:
-3.0 RS
-959
-3.2 CS
-964 RS
-993 RS
-993 GT2
-996 GT3
-996 Turbo
-996 GT2
Note: EVO rated these as the top ten rated 911s of all time.
Here's EVO last paragraph in the article:
"So, there you have it. The consensus after two days' driving is that the greatest is the 2.7 RS, which is also the oldest of our group. I can't help feeling that there's a message here for Porsche, if it's interested.
The new 996 GT2 is a sensational car but the most impressive of the recent 911s is the GT3. 'By far the best 996 generation car,' says Meaden. 'Maybe one day I will find something I do not like about this car,' adds Hayman.
And it wouldn't have taken much to put the GT3 into close-quarters contention with the 2.7 RS, either - maybe a few less creature comforts, some thinner glass, a few lightweight panels...
In short, what we'd really like is a 996 RS.
COME ON PORSCHE, WE KNOW YOU CAN DO IT!"
